Why Fairhaven Decks Wear Differently Than Decks Inland

Fairhaven sits close enough to the water that its homes take on a different set of problems than a deck built twenty miles inland in Whatcom County. Salt-laden air corrodes fasteners and hardware faster than plain moisture does. Driving rain off Bellingham Bay finds its way sideways under flashing and into end grain that would otherwise stay dry. And the long, mild, wet stretch of fall through spring gives moss and algae months to get established on any board that doesn't drain and dry quickly. None of this means a deck in Fairhaven is doomed — it means the repair has to account for conditions a generic "deck fix" doesn't always consider.

What Salt Air, Rain, and Moss Actually Do to a Deck

Corrosion You Can't Always See

Salt air accelerates corrosion on any metal it touches — joist hangers, structural screws, bolts, and nails. A fastener that would last two decades in a dry inland climate can start rusting and weakening years sooner near the water. The visible surface of a deck can look fine while the hardware holding it together is quietly failing underneath. This is the single biggest reason we insist on checking connections, not just decking boards, on every Fairhaven repair.

Water That Doesn't Drain

Driving rain doesn't fall straight down — it gets pushed under railings, behind ledger boards, and into any gap where flashing is missing or has failed. Once water gets behind a board or into a ledger connection, it stays wet far longer than the surface does, which is exactly the environment that causes rot to spread from the inside out.

Moss, Algae, and the Slip Hazard Nobody Talks About

Whatcom County's wet season runs long, and any deck surface that stays shaded or doesn't shed water well will grow moss. Beyond looking bad, moss holds moisture against the wood surface and creates a genuinely dangerous walking surface when wet. Pressure washing moss off without addressing why it's growing there (poor drainage, low airflow, wrong finish) just means it comes back within a season.

Repair or Replace? How We Make That Call

Not every deck problem needs a full rebuild, and not every deck should be patched. The honest answer depends on what's failing and where.

Condition FoundUsually RepairableUsually Needs Replacement
Surface graying, mild moss, minor splinteringYes — cleaning, sanding, refinishingNo
A few soft or cracked deck boardsYes — board-by-board replacementNo, unless widespread
Rusted or loose joist hangers and fastenersSometimes — hardware swap if framing is soundIf corrosion has spread through multiple connections
Soft or spongy framing, joists, or beamsRarely — depends on extentYes, if structural members are compromised
Ledger board separating from the houseSometimes — reflash and refastenYes, if rot has reached the rim joist or sheathing
Railing posts loose or rotted at the baseYes — post and connection repairIf rot has traveled into the deck framing

The general rule: if the problem is at the surface — boards, railings, finish — repair almost always makes sense. If the problem has reached the framing that carries structural load, we tell you plainly, because a deck that looks solid but flexes or bounces underfoot isn't something we'll patch over cosmetically.

What a Correct Deck Repair Actually Involves

Framing and Structural Checks First

Before we replace a single board, we check the framing underneath — joists, beams, and especially the ledger board connection to the house, since that's the point most exposed to water intrusion and the point that carries the most load. A repair that skips this step and only replaces what's visible on top can leave a hidden problem to keep growing.

Decking Boards and Surface

Boards get replaced individually where they're damaged rather than assuming the whole surface needs to go. We match spacing and fastening to allow proper drainage and airflow underneath, since tight, poorly ventilated decking is what invites moss and slow rot in the first place.

Railings and Guards

Railings take abuse from weather and use, and a loose or rotted post is a safety issue, not just a cosmetic one. We check post connections down to the framing, not just at the surface, since a railing can look tight while its base connection has already failed.

Fasteners and Hardware

Given the corrosion risk from salt air, we don't reuse compromised hardware just to save a step. Fasteners and connectors get matched to the exposure the deck actually faces.

Flashing and Water Management

Flashing at the ledger board and any point where the deck meets the house is what keeps driving rain from working its way into the structure. A repair that replaces boards but ignores failed or missing flashing is treating a symptom, not the cause.

Materials: What We Use and Why

MaterialStrengthsTrade-offs in This Climate
Pressure-treated woodCost-effective, easy to repair board-by-boardNeeds regular sealing/staining to resist moisture and moss; fasteners must be rated for treated lumber
CedarNaturally rot-resistant, attractive finishStill needs finish maintenance near salt air; softer surface can show wear faster
Composite deckingLow maintenance, resists rot and moss buildup on the surfaceHigher upfront cost; framing underneath still needs the same moisture protection as any deck

We don't push one material as universally "best." The right choice depends on your budget, how much upkeep you want to do, and how exposed the deck is. What we won't do is install any decking material over framing or flashing that hasn't been properly addressed — that's a maintenance and warranty problem waiting to happen, regardless of what's on top.

Maintenance Checklist for Fairhaven Homeowners

  • Sweep debris and standing moisture off the deck surface regularly during the wet months
  • Check for moss buildup in shaded or low-airflow areas and clean it before it spreads
  • Inspect railings and posts for looseness at least once a year
  • Look underneath the deck periodically for rust streaks or corrosion on hardware
  • Check the ledger board and flashing at the house connection for gaps or staining
  • Reseal or restain wood decking on the schedule appropriate to the product used
  • Address soft or discolored boards promptly rather than waiting for them to worsen

How often should a deck near the water get inspected compared to one further inland?

We'd suggest checking a Fairhaven-area deck at least once a year, focusing on hardware and the ledger connection, since salt air speeds up corrosion that isn't always visible from the surface. Inland decks can often go a bit longer between close inspections. Catching corrosion early is far cheaper than replacing failed framing later.

What should I ask a contractor before hiring them for deck repair?

Ask whether they inspect framing and hardware or just replace visible boards, since a repair that skips the structure underneath can leave hidden problems. Ask how they handle flashing at the house connection, and ask for a written scope that separates cosmetic work from structural work. A contractor who can't explain the difference clearly is worth being cautious about.

Is composite decking worth the extra cost over wood in this climate?

It depends on your priorities. Composite reduces surface maintenance and resists moss buildup better than untreated wood, but it costs more upfront and doesn't reduce the need to protect the framing and hardware underneath, which face the same salt-air and moisture exposure either way.

What's the actual difference between pressure-treated lumber and cedar for a repaired deck?

Pressure-treated lumber is treated with preservatives to resist rot and is generally the more budget-friendly option, while cedar has natural rot resistance and a different appearance but still needs regular sealing in a wet, salt-exposed climate. Both require fasteners rated for the specific wood type to avoid premature corrosion.

Does Whatcom County's climate affect what fasteners or hardware should be used on a Fairhaven deck?

Yes — the combination of salt air and a long wet season makes corrosion-resistant fasteners and connectors more important here than in a drier inland location. Using standard hardware not rated for this exposure is a common shortcut that leads to hidden failures well before the visible decking shows any wear.
